Beautiful image Pete, very painterly. Can you tell me your settings?
Thanks Bill.

ISO 400, 0.4 sec at f10 with a 6 stop ND filter. Manual focus pre-set about 2/3 into frame. Lots of unsuccessful attempts!

St Peter's Church, Old Edlington.

The nave dates back to Norman times whilst the tower is relatively new, being built in the 14th century.

Couldn't get very far back, so this is 3 vertical shots stitched together (which makes for a bit of distortion on part of the nave)
